如何管理DevOps的文档流程
-
DevOps的文档流程管理是建立有效的沟通和协作机制,以确保团队成员能够及时获取所需的文档,并对其进行更新和维护。以下是管理DevOps文档流程的几个重要方面:
1. 定义文档需求和目标
在开始管理文档流程之前,团队应该明确定义文档的需求和目标。这包括确定文档类型、内容和格式,以及确定文档的存储和访问方式。例如,团队可以使用wiki系统来存储技术文档,使用协作工具来存储和共享项目文档。2. 建立文档流程管理工具和系统
为了有效管理DevOps文档流程,团队应该建立适当的工具和系统。这些工具和系统可以包括版本控制系统(如Git),用于存储和跟踪文档的协作平台(如Confluence)和项目管理工具(如Jira)。使用这些工具可以帮助团队更好地管理文档的版本控制、共享和更新。3. 制定文档编写和更新规范
为了确保文档的质量和一致性,团队应该制定文档编写和更新的规范。这些规范可以包括文档的结构、格式和风格要求。团队成员在编写和更新文档时应该遵循这些规范,以确保文档的易读性和易维护性。4. 进行文档评审和验证
为了确保文档的准确性和有效性,团队应该进行文档评审和验证。通过对文档进行评审,可以发现并纠正潜在的错误和不完整性。团队成员也应该在编写和更新文档后进行自我验证,以确保文档的准确性和可理解性。5. 维护文档更新和版本控制
团队应定期维护和更新文档,以反映项目的最新状态和需求。更新的文档应通过版本控制系统进行管理,以便团队成员可以方便地查看文档的历史记录和变更。6. 提供培训和支持
为了确保团队成员能够有效地使用文档流程管理工具和系统,团队应提供培训和支持。这包括培训团队成员使用文档流程管理工具、了解文档编写和更新规范,以及提供必要的技术支持和指导。7. 追踪和改进文档流程
为了不断改进文档流程管理,团队应该追踪文档流程的效率和效果。通过收集反馈和数据,团队可以确定需要改进的地方,并采取相应的措施来提高文档流程的效率和质量。综上所述,管理DevOps的文档流程需要明确定义需求和目标,建立适当的工具和系统,制定规范,进行评审和验证,维护更新和版本控制,提供培训和支持,以及追踪和改进文档流程。通过有效的文档流程管理,团队可以提高沟通和协作效率,并确保项目的顺利进行。
2年前 -
DevOps的文档流程管理可以通过以下五个步骤来实施:
1. 设立文档管理策略:首先,组织应该设立一套明确的文档管理策略,以规范化和标准化文档的创建、更新、审批和存储等过程。策略应该明确文档的分类、命名规范、版本控制机制以及文档的权限管理等细节。这有助于提高团队的效率和一致性,并减少潜在的错误和混乱。
2. 使用版本控制系统:DevOps团队应该使用版本控制系统,如Git或Subversion等来管理文档的版本。这样可以轻松地追踪文档的变化历史并进行版本比较与恢复。同时,版本控制系统也提供了协作工具,允许多人同时编辑和审批文档,避免了文档的重复和冲突。
3. 自动化文档生成和更新:为了减少人工劳动和保持文档的实时性,可以使用自动化工具来生成和更新文档。例如,可以使用自动化测试工具生成测试报告、使用构建工具生成部署文档等。通过自动化,文档可以与实际的操作过程保持同步,并减少团队成员手动维护文档的工作量。
4. 集成文档流程到CI/CD流程中:文档的更新应该与代码的提交和发布流程相集成。当代码发生变化时,相应的文档也应该进行更新。可以通过在持续集成和持续交付流程中添加文档更新的环节来确保这一点。这样可以保证文档的即时性和准确性,并避免文档过时和不一致的问题。
5. 定期审查和更新文档:最后,团队应该定期审查和更新文档,确保其与实际操作保持一致。技术和业务环境的变化可能导致文档失效或不准确,因此应该在团队会议或项目验收时进行文档检查和更新。此外,也可以建立一个反馈机制,接收用户和团队成员的意见和建议,帮助改进文档质量和流程。
通过以上步骤,可以有效地管理DevOps的文档流程,提高团队的效率和一致性,并减少潜在的错误和混乱。
2年前 -
DevOps的文档流程管理是一个关键的环节,可以帮助团队更好地进行项目管理和协作。下面是一种常见的DevOps文档流程管理方法:
1. 确定文档的目标和受众:在开始编写文档之前,需要明确文档的目标和受众。文档可以有不同的目标,如说明安装和部署过程、指导操作操作流程、解释规范和标准等。根据目标和受众的不同,需要使用不同的文档类型和格式。
2. 创建文档模板:为了统一风格和格式,可以创建文档模板。文档模板应包括标题、目录、引言、正文、参考文献等部分,以便读者能够快速定位和查找信息。模板还可以包含一些常见的示例和示意图,以帮助读者更好地理解内容。
3. 编写文档内容:根据目标和受众的要求,编写文档的正文内容。文档应该简洁明了,用清晰的语言和逻辑结构表达观点。同时,为了增加可读性,可以使用标题、子标题、列表和图表等排版技巧。在编写内容时,应注意使用简洁明了的语句,避免使用专业术语和复杂的技术概念。
4. 审核和修改:在完成文档编写后,需要进行审核和修改。审阅人员可以是团队中的其他成员或专业领域的技术专家,他们应该对文档内容进行细致的检查,并提出修改意见和建议。修改后的文档应再次进行审核,直到文档符合要求为止。
5. 存储和版本控制:为了方便查找和管理文档,需要将其存储在指定的位置,并使用版本控制工具进行管理。版本控制可以追踪文档的修改历史,并允许团队成员协同编辑和合并文档。一些常见的版本控制工具包括Git和SVN等。
6. 发布和分发:在审核和修改完成后,可以考虑将文档发布和分发给相关的团队成员或用户。文档可以以在线文档或下载文件的形式发布,并通过邮件、内部网站、团队聊天工具等途径通知团队成员和用户。
7. 更新和维护:随着项目的进行和技术的发展,文档也需要进行更新和维护。团队成员应该定期回顾和更新文档,以确保其与实际情况保持一致。同时,团队成员也可以根据实际需要添加新的文档或删除过时的文档。
通过以上方法,可以有效地管理DevOps的文档流程,提高团队的管理效率和项目的协作能力。
2年前